Weapon in Tupac Murder Missing

It has been almost 21 years since the death of hip hop legend Tupac Shakur and even today many still discuss the case debating what really happened. It has been reported today that the gun used to kill the artist is currently missing. In 1998 it was found and reported to the police then in 2000 the gun was transferred along with 38,000 firearms from the Compton Police Department to the Los Angeles County Sheriff’s Department. In 2006 the gun was found by Deputy Brennan of LASD at the home of a gang member and a ballistic test proved that it was the gun that was used to kill Tupac. A federal prosecutor ordered for the gun to not be transferred to the Las Vegas Police Department because he feared the discovery would alert conspirators and now the gun is currently missing. After A&E producers tried to reach out to both departments’ officers were unsure of what happened to the gun.
